How many are you booking for? Initially I tried to book Droid Depot for 4 people and there was no availability. But then I tried to book for 2 and it was basically wide open. So I booked 2 people at 3 PM and 2 people at 3:05 PM. So for anyone who is trying to book for more than 2 people, I would suggest breaking it down into 2 person groups.

the credit card is just to guarantee your reservation and in the event of a no show that is what will be charged. You can use gift cards or another credit/debit card or cash once inside

I posted this previously but was directed to post on this thread. I have booked Savi's at 12:05, Droid at 1:00 and Ogs's at 2:00. Does this seem like a good timeline? Do you get right in for your reservation time for these experiences?
Savi's seems to take roughly a half hour from check in and picking what set you want to use to actually getting out of there, saber in hand. Droid building is about the same, depending on how long it takes you to choose your parts. This is a pretty solid timeline - you'll basically be able to go from one to another no problem, with very little downtime (but enough breathing room) in between.
